  • Welcome to the Dearborn KinderCare on Evergreen Road. We are pleased that you have chosen to look at our center for your child's care and educational needs. We look forward for the opportunity to expand our family and welcome new families to the neighborhood. Here at the Dearborn KinderCare, we believe that each child is a unique individual. We are sensitive to their social, emotional, intellectual and physical needs. Our curriculum is developmentally appropriate and we focus on the process of learning so that your children enjoy successful experiences. The staff is committed to providing high quality care and eduction to all the children in our center. This is a place where children, parents and staff grow together, dream big and feel a sense of belonging.
  • Our center has secured keypad entry and fenced playgrounds for your child's added safety. Our staff are all trained and are certified in CPR, First Aid and Bloodborne Pathogens.
  • Hours Of Operation: 6:30 AM to 6:30 PM, M-F
  • Languages Spoken: American_sign_langugage, Arabic, Hindi, Mandarin, Spanish
  • Enrollment: Min Age - 6 Weeks, Max Age - 12 Years
  • State subsidy assistance $75 per child per week co-pay, any subsidy program from state, they have to go to DHS to find out if qualify and Center has Child Development and Care provider verification form with the provider ID that they can get on their tour
  • Infant Programs (6 Weeks – 1 Year), Toddler Programs (1 – 2 Years), Discovery Preschool Programs (2 – 3 Years), Preschool Programs (3 – 4 Years), Prekindergarten Programs (4 – 5 Years), Before and After School Programs (5–12 Years), Summer Programs (preschool, prekindergarten, and school-age)
